Update at 22:45 local time ....

The solution is easier than I'd hoped!

http://newmars.com/forums/profile.php?id=430138

Pull ID from profile url in address bar

Make http://newmars.com/forums/misc.php?email=430138

append numeric value to: http://newmars.com/forums/misc.php?email=

Put result in address bar

Send enter

No need for a mouse click at all!

Update a bit later ... this new strategy is ** much ** more efficient, but it ** will ** require a new script command.

PullIDfromAddressSave:# <<== this would pull the digits to right of "id=" and save them in the storage row indicated by #

It should be possible to put that command into the program tomorrow morning.
